Why 3/4 Air Hose Is Necessary

I’ve found that a 3/4 air hose is necessary when I need better airflow for larger tools and heavier jobs. In my experience, the wider diameter helps reduce pressure loss, so my equipment performs more consistently, especially when I’m working with air tools that demand a strong and steady supply of compressed air.

My biggest reason for using a 3/4 air hose is efficiency. I notice that it can handle higher air volume, which makes it a better choice for longer runs and more demanding applications. When I use smaller hoses, I often deal with reduced performance, but with a 3/4 hose, my tools stay more responsive and reliable.

I also appreciate the durability and versatility it gives me. For tasks where I need dependable airflow over distance, this hose size gives me more confidence that my setup will work properly without constant drops in pressure. For me, that makes a 3/4 air hose a practical and necessary choice.

My Buying Guides on 3 4 Air Hose

What I Look for First

When I shop for a 3/4 air hose, I first check the hose diameter, length, and working pressure. I want to make sure it matches the air tools I use and the compressor I already have. If the hose is too small or not rated for enough pressure, I know it can restrict airflow and make my tools perform poorly.

Why Hose Material Matters to Me

I always pay attention to the material because it affects flexibility, durability, and weight. Rubber hoses feel more flexible in cold weather, while hybrid hoses are often lighter and easier for me to move around. PVC hoses may cost less, but I usually avoid them if I need something that stays flexible and lasts longer.

Length and Reach

I choose the hose length based on where I work. If I need to move around a large garage or jobsite, I prefer a longer hose so I do not have to keep relocating my compressor. At the same time, I avoid buying a hose that is unnecessarily long because extra length can reduce airflow and make storage harder.

Pressure Rating and Airflow

I always check the maximum PSI rating and the hose’s airflow capacity. A hose with a higher pressure rating gives me more confidence when I use demanding tools. I also look at whether the hose can maintain good airflow, since that directly affects how well my impact wrench, nailer, or spray gun performs.

Fittings and Compatibility

I make sure the fittings match my compressor and air tools before I buy. I prefer corrosion-resistant fittings because they last longer and connect more securely. If the fittings are not compatible, I know I will end up spending extra time and money on adapters.

Flexibility and Kink Resistance

In my experience, a hose that resists kinking saves a lot of frustration. I like hoses that stay flexible even when I drag them across the floor or use them in cooler weather. A hose that twists or coils too much can slow me down and wear out faster.

Durability and Reinforcement

I look for reinforced construction if I plan to use the hose often. A tough outer layer helps protect it from abrasion, while internal reinforcement helps it handle pressure better. Since I want my hose to last, I usually avoid thin hoses that look like they will crack or wear out quickly.

Weight and Ease of Handling

Because I often carry my hose around the shop, I prefer one that is light enough to handle comfortably. A heavy hose can become tiring during long projects. I try to balance weight with durability so I do not sacrifice strength just to get something easier to move.

Storage and Maintenance

I also think about how easy the hose is to store. A hose that coils neatly is much easier for me to keep organized. I make it a habit to drain moisture, avoid sharp bends, and store it away from heat and sunlight so it stays in good condition longer.

My Final Buying Advice

When I buy a 3/4 air hose, I focus on matching it to my tools, checking pressure and airflow ratings, and choosing a material that fits my work style. For me, the best hose is one that balances flexibility, durability, and compatibility. If I get those basics right, I know I will end up with a hose that performs well and lasts a long time.
